- The distance between Oshkosh, Wi, Usa and Blantyre, Malawi is approximately 13,872 km or 8,620 mi.
- To reach Oshkosh, Wi in this distance one would set out from Blantyre bearing 313.1°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Oshkosh, Wi bearing 257.7° or WSW .
- Oshkosh, Wi has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a) whereas Blantyre has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Oshkosh, Wi is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Blantyre is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 15.3 °C (27.6°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 24.7 °C (44.5°F) more in Oshkosh, Wi.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 42.8 mm (1.7 in) less which is equivalent to 42.8 l/m² (1.05 US gal/ft²) or 428,000 l/ha (45,756 US gal/ac) less.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 24.6° lower in Oshkosh, Wi than in Blantyre.
